Microsoft has made a website outlining the benefits of the Activision Blizzard deal

Microsoft has decided to pitch its views in on its Activision deal by launching a website to show the benefits of the acquisition of Activision Blizzard. The deal has come under fire by Sony as well as competition regulators and watchdogs for fears that it will negatively effect the gaming industry.

The website outlines the “vision for gaming” Xbox has and states what it claims are the benefits of the $68.7 billion deal for players, game developers, and the gaming industry overall.

Xbox states that its deal will lead to more games on more devices alongside more choice when it comes to purchasing games and variety for mobile gamers.

For game developers, Xbox has stated that the deal will make it easier for more gamers to access their games, lead to fairer marketplace rules, and allow for flexibility in payment systems. Additionally, Xbox says that the games industry will benefit from increased competition. Xbox also said that Sony and Nintendo will still remain the largest publishers despite the deal.

Xbox also put an “emphasis on positive workplace culture.” No specifics were stated about what Xbox was referencing, but it is most likely the controversy that has surrounded Activision Blizzard over the last year. Activision was accused of encouraging a “frat boy culture” in a lawsuit filed by California.

Despite the scrutiny surrounding the deal, Xbox boss Phil Spencer and Microsoft stated that they feel confident that the deal will go through.
